Kurdish Authorities Say Turkish Assault Displaces 275,000 In Northern Syria

DAMASCUS, Oct 16 (NNN-SANA) – The Kurdish Autonomous Administration of North and East Syria, known as Rojava, said, the ongoing Turkish assault in northern Syria, so far displaced over 275,000 people.
